Максим Сидоров — Как избавиться от рекурсии и исправить глупую ошибку в Google

Подробнее о Java-конференциях: — весной — JPoint:
— осенью — Joker:
— — Скачать презентацию с сайта JPoint —
Спикер рассказал про исследование различных подходов к оптимизации рекурсии. Рассмотрел и сравнил их между собой, чтобы получить наглядные цифры. Кроме того, осветил оптимизацию хвостовой рекурсии, рекурсии при обходе деревьев, любой рекурсии через DeepRecursiveFunction. Рассказал, как во время исследования обнаружил и исправил глупую ошибку в коде Google, связанную c попыткой оптимизации рекурсии.

Смотрите также